Case in point, Trump has been trying to float his authoritarian aspirations to tyranny by proposing that he extend his occupation of the White House into a constitutionally prohibited third term. The 22nd Amendment states plainly that "No person shall be elected to the office of the President more than twice." But mere laws can't dampen Trump's lust for power. When asked about this by Meet the Press moderator Kristen Welker, Trump replied that "I’m not joking...There are methods which you could do it."
Of course there are. Vladimir Putin did it. Xi Jinping did it. Viktor Orbán did it. And if Trump's idols can do it, so can he. Right? And Trump's press Secretary, Karoline Leavitt, is more than happy to patronize his despotic dreams. When the matter came up on Fox News, Leavitt declined to refute the madness expressed by her boss, saying that...
"It's funny to me that journalists ask the president this question. He gives an honest and candid answer and then they spiral about his answer. He was asked this, and you heard him, and he's right. People love the job this president is doing. And as he said, we are focused on this term. We have four more years to go."
x Leavitt: It's funny to me that journalists ask the president this question. He gives an honest and candid answer and then they spiral about his answer pic.twitter.com/HLcEgFSrVO — Acyn (@Acyn) March 31, 2025
Notice that Leavitt never actually denies that Trump is harboring unhinged hopes of declaring himself president-for-life. Instead, she just lies about his popularity, as if that would justify undermining democracy and taking over the country as its new dictator. For the record, Trump sits at the bottom of the popularity polls for presidents at this point in their terms.
